
Researchers have uncovered a critical vulnerability in Zoom's screen-sharing feature that could allow attackers to take over devices during a call. The flaw was identified using AI models, which rapidly pinpointed the issue with fewer than 20 prompts. Zoom has issued patches to address the vulnerability, which affected all supported operating systems. This incident highlights the increasing ease with which AI can be used to find and exploit software vulnerabilities, raising concerns about the security of trusted platforms.

© WIRED AIAI is emerging as a promising tool in the fight against the global fatty liver epidemic, which affects about 30% of adults worldwide. By analyzing electronic health records and routine medical tests, AI can identify individuals at risk of developing severe liver conditions early on, potentially reversing damage through lifestyle changes and new treatments. This approach could alleviate the burden on healthcare systems by reducing the need for invasive procedures and expensive treatments like liver transplants. While still largely in the research phase, AI's integration into routine diagnostics could transform liver care by catching cases earlier and more accurately.

Google's Pixel Watch 5 is making strides in AI-driven health monitoring, with features like Breathing Emergency Detection and insulin resistance trends. These updates aim to provide users with proactive health insights, leveraging AI to interpret data from sensors for non-diagnostic wellness alerts. The watch also promises improved GPS accuracy by using AI to process satellite and environmental data. While the hardware changes are minimal, the software enhancements position the Pixel Watch 5 as a more intelligent health companion, potentially setting a new standard for wearable health tech.

The 'Apple Reference Image' system, found in iOS 27 beta, embeds provenance metadata into photos at the moment of capture. This metadata can be used to authenticate the photo's origin and integrity through Apple's Private Cloud Compute servers. While not yet live, this feature could set a new standard for photo verification, offering a more robust solution compared to existing systems like C2PA.
